Default How illegal immigrants impact the electoral college

When the government conducts the census it counts illegal immigrants and other noncitizens. This means that states like California will benefit with additional representation in the House and in the electoral college. No wonder why the left doesn't want to deport the illegals.

Hillary: Illegal Immigrants Could Elect Clinton - POLITICO Magazine


The article is about a year old, but it does a good job at explaining the impact that noncitizens have on our election. I like the electoral college system, but we really need to shore up our borders and deport illegal immigrants. In theory, the entire country of Mexico could be counted in the census and really skew our election.
